在当今复杂的网络开发与安全分析领域,选择一款高效、稳定且功能全面的调试工具,是提升开发效率与保障项目质量的关键。360开发人员工具作为国内安全领域极具代表性的调试解决方案,其核心价值在于将底层协议分析、漏洞检测与日常开发调试深度融合,为技术人员提供了一站式的安全开发环境,该工具不仅支持多浏览器内核切换,更在数据包抓取、代码注入测试及性能监控方面表现出极高的专业度,能够帮助开发者快速定位前端兼容性问题与后端接口逻辑漏洞,是构建安全可靠应用系统的必备利器。

核心功能架构与技术优势
该工具的设计初衷是为了解决开发过程中“调试难、抓包难、模拟难”的三大痛点,其功能架构遵循了极简主义与高性能并重的原则,主要体现在以下几个核心维度:
-
全方位的抓包与协议分析能力
工具内置了高性能的网络抓包模块,能够实时监控HTTP/HTTPS请求。它不仅支持常规的请求头与响应体查看,更具备SSL/TLS解密能力,让加密数据流一目了然,开发者可以通过过滤规则快速筛选特定域名的请求,分析数据传输格式,排查接口调用失败的根本原因,对于移动端开发者,该工具还提供了代理配置功能,轻松实现移动端应用的流量捕获与调试。 -
多内核兼容性与渲染诊断
针对国内复杂的浏览器环境,特别是基于Chromium与IE双内核的兼容场景,该工具提供了强大的内核切换与渲染诊断功能。开发者无需安装多款浏览器,即可在工具内部模拟不同的渲染引擎,快速发现因内核差异导致的CSS样式错乱或JavaScript脚本执行异常,这一功能极大地缩短了前端适配的测试周期,确保了网页在各类环境下的稳定运行。 -
安全漏洞扫描与代码审计
区别于普通的开发者工具,安全检测是其差异化竞争的核心,工具集成了自动化的代码审计与漏洞扫描引擎,能够在编码阶段即时提示潜在的安全风险,如XSS跨站脚本攻击、SQL注入隐患等。这种“开发即安全”的左移理念,帮助团队在代码构建初期就规避了大部分安全风险,降低了后期修复成本。
实战应用场景与解决方案
在实际的技术工作流中,工具的价值往往体现在解决具体问题的效率上,以下列举了三个高频应用场景,展示该工具如何提供专业解决方案:

-
复杂API接口的联调与Mock测试
在前后端分离的开发模式下,接口联调往往成为项目进度的瓶颈,利用该工具的Mock数据功能,前端开发者可以独立于后端进度,自定义接口返回数据结构。通过断点拦截请求并修改响应内容,能够模拟各种边界情况(如服务器错误、数据为空、超时等),从而验证前端逻辑的健壮性,这种独立的调试模式显著提升了团队的并行开发效率。 -
网页性能瓶颈的深度剖析
当页面加载缓慢或资源阻塞时,工具提供的性能分析面板能够给出详尽的瀑布流图,通过分析Time to First Byte (TTFB)、DOM Content Loaded等关键指标,开发者可以精准定位是网络延迟、资源体积过大还是脚本执行耗时过长导致的问题。基于数据的优化建议,如开启Gzip压缩、合并CSS文件或使用CDN加速,能够直接指导性能优化工作。 -
移动端H5页面的真机调试
移动端H5开发常面临机型碎片化与系统版本差异的挑战,该工具支持通过USB连接或Wi-Fi连接进行真机远程调试。开发者可以在PC端直接查看手机浏览器的控制台日志、DOM结构和网络请求,实现了桌面端与移动端的无缝对接,这一功能彻底解决了移动端调试“盲人摸象”的困境。
专业开发者的使用建议
为了最大化发挥工具效能,建议技术团队在使用过程中遵循以下最佳实践:
-
建立标准化的调试流程
将工具的使用纳入代码提交前的自测环节,利用其自动化测试脚本功能,对核心业务流程进行回归测试。规范化的调试日志存档,有助于后续的问题复盘与知识沉淀。 -
结合安全开发规范
不要仅将工具用于功能调试,应定期使用其安全扫描模块对项目进行“体检”,针对工具报告的高危漏洞,应建立专门的修复追踪机制,确保代码上线前达到安全合规标准。
-
定制化插件扩展
利用工具开放的插件接口,根据团队特定的技术栈开发定制化插件,封装内部接口签名算法,实现请求参数的自动签名,减少手动计算签名的时间消耗,提升开发体验。
这款调试工具凭借其在网络分析、兼容性测试及安全检测方面的深厚积累,已成为技术团队提升工程化能力的重要抓手,它不仅简化了繁琐的调试过程,更通过安全能力的植入,为软件质量构筑了坚实的防线。
相关问答
该工具在处理HTTPS抓包时显示“未知”或无法解密怎么办?
这种情况通常是由于证书未正确安装或信任设置不当导致的,解决方案如下:
- 打开工具的设置面板,找到“证书管理”选项。
- 点击“导出根证书”,并将证书安装到系统的受信任根证书颁发机构存储区。
- 确保在浏览器或移动设备设置中,对该证书开启了“信任”权限。
- 重启工具与浏览器,再次进行抓包,通常即可正常解析加密流量。
如何利用该工具快速定位页面中的CSS样式冲突?
利用元素审查功能可以高效解决此问题:
- 点击工具栏中的“元素选择器”图标。
- 在页面中点击目标元素,工具将自动定位到对应的HTML代码。
- 在右侧的样式面板中,查看被划掉的样式属性,这些即为被覆盖或冲突的样式。
- 鼠标悬停在生效的样式上,工具会显示该样式的来源文件及行号,方便快速修改。
如果您在开发过程中有独特的调试技巧或遇到了难以解决的技术难题,欢迎在评论区留言交流。
首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/157564.html